Trotter, Captain Philip Durham.
Our Mission to the Court of Marocco in 1880 under Sir John Drummond Hay, K.C.B., Minister Plenipotentiary and Envoy Extraordinary to his Majesty the Sultan [PRESENTATION COPY].
 
Publisher: David Douglas, Edinburgh;
Date of Publication: 1881
Stock Code: 14379
 
First edition. Octavo, pp., xviii, 306, [4] of index, plus 31 photographic plates of the expedition, and folding map of the region to end, as called for. Publisher’s olive-green cloth, badge in gilt to upper board, within black-stamped ornamental frame, titled in gilt to spine; upper edge gilt. Boldly inscribed “Bertram Goff 71st Hightlanders from The Author June 1881” to front free end-paper. Hinges cracked, boards a little rubbed, corners bumped and rubbed, text-block shaken. Contents clean and bright. A very good copy.
 
A scarce account of an expedition by a captain of the 93rd Highlanders that went from Tangier to Fez, then to Mekenes and Rabat, returning to Sla Mehedia, El-Araish, and Azila.
